MOTION TO WITHDRAW PURSUANT TO ANDERS V. CALIFORNIA, 386 U.S. 738 (1967)

TO THE HONORABLE JUSTICES OF SAID COURT:

COMES NOW EMILY DETOTO, counsel for appellant MICHAEL

ODURO KWARTENG, and hereby moves to withdraw from representation of

appellant pursuant to Anders v. California, 386 U.S. 738 (1967). In support of this

motion, counsel shows as follows:

Counsel has thoroughly reviewed the record on appeal and is thoroughly

familiar with the case.

Counsel has, in the exercise of her professional judgment, determined that

the instant case presents no non-frivolous issues for appeal. Thus, in accordance

with Anders v. California, 386 U.S. 738 (1967), counsel now requests permission

to withdraw. Anders, 386 U.S. at 744.

1 In accordance with Anders, counsel has, contemporaneously with this

motion, filed a brief outlining all issues which might arguably support an appeal

and explaining why those issues are meritless. Id.

Counsel has furnished the appellant with a copy of the brief and a copy of

this motion, thereby apprising appellant of counsel’s actions.

Having determined that the instant appeal is wholly frivolous and having

complied with the briefing and notice requirements of Anders, counsel now

requests that she be allowed to withdraw.

WHEREFORE PREMISES CONSIDERED, the Counsel for Appellant

respectfully prays that the Court grant her request and allow counsel to withdraw

from this case.
